Psalm 139:1-3
"1 O LORD, thou hast searched me, and known me.
2 Thou knowest my downsitting and mine uprising, thou understandest my thought afar off.
3 Thou compassest my path and my lying down, and art acquainted with all my ways."
God KNOWS you.
We have completed our series studying the LAST DAYS. Concluding with knowing that we need to pray for God to help us every step of the way. We need to align our THINKING and PLANNING with God's. God’s perspective is not bound by time, space, or human limitations. He sees the beginning and the end, and His ways are guided by His eternal and infinite wisdom. Accepting God’s ways means trusting in His sovereignty and wisdom, even when we don’t understand His plans or actions.
While we need to work to understand GOD, God KNOWS us. Today's verses describe this VERY well. "O LORD, thou hast SEARCHED me, and KNOWN me. Thou KNOWEST my downsitting and mine uprising, thou UNDERSTANDEST my thought afar off. Thou COMPASSEST my path and my lying down, and art ACQUAINTED with ALL MY WAYS." God KNOWS you. His knowledge of you is a powerful reminder of His love and acceptance. As you seek to understand God’s omniscience, remember that you are known and loved by Him, and that He is always working to bring you closer to Himself! And, that's REALLY INCREDIBLE!!
